"Hello,i have a 1985 26' SeaRay CC with a 260 merc i/o, the boat sits in the slip with about a 3 inch drop(list) on the starboard side. I took everything out of the boat so there is no extra weight. the batteries are in there factory compartments on either side of the engine. The bilge is bone dry! any ideas why this boat is not sitting even?? Thanks in advance, Ken"
 
"Well that depends on how long

"Well that depends on how long it has been that way. It could have been that way since day one. It may have something installed by a previous owner which threw off the balance. Has a genset or A/C system been added? It could have water captured in th stringer system or laminate. You may try shifting some weight to temporarily correct the list. A permanent fix is to have the boat weighted and compared to the new, listed weight as printed by SeaRay. Sea Ray does have a history of water intrusion into the hull lamination in some of their models, but I wouldn't fret until I could confirm that.

Some stringer drilling and a moisture meter may be in order.

"Ken, I would drill some test

"Ken, I would drill some test holes before I ripped out the floor, then I would use the boat for the remainder of the season and then plan a winter project.

It's a short, short boating season and a long, long winter."
